What this skill does
# Feishu Docx PowerWrite This skill focuses on **reliably writing great-looking Feishu Docx** using OpenClaw’s Feishu OpenAPI tools. Key idea: prefer **`feishu_docx_write_markdown`** (Markdown → Docx blocks) for structure-preserving output. ## Quick workflow 1) Get `document_id` (Docx token) - From a Docx URL: `https://.../docx/<document_id>` 2) Decide write mode - **Append**: add new content below existing content (most common) - **Replace**: overwrite the entire document (use carefully) 3) Write markdown - Use headings + lists + short paragraphs - Avoid huge single paragraphs (harder to read) ## Recommended defaults ### Append mode (safe) Use when adding sections, meeting notes, daily logs. - `mode: append` - Keep each append chunk <= ~300-600 lines if possible ### Replace mode (destructive) Use when generating the full doc from scratch. - `mode: replace` - MUST set `confirm: true` ## Markdown patterns that render well ### Title + summary ```md # <Title> **Summary** - Point 1 - Point 2 --- ``` ### Sections ```md ## Section Short paragraph. - Bullet - Bullet ### Subsection 1) Step 2) Step ``` ### Code Use fenced blocks. ```md ```bash openclaw skills check ``` ``` ## Templates & references - Templates: `references/templates.md` - Troubleshooting: `references/troubleshooting.md` ## Safety / privacy - Never hardcode tokens, chat_id, open_id, or document links inside this skill. - Always use the user’s own Feishu app credentials and scopes.
